Introduction to Remote Calibration Services

Remote calibration services have revolutionized the automotive industry by enabling technicians to perform calibration adjustments without the need for physical access to the vehicle. This innovative approach utilizes advanced technology to ensure vehicles are functioning optimally, enhancing overall performance and efficiency. The benefits of remote calibration are numerous, including reduced downtime, increased convenience for both technicians and vehicle owners, and improved accuracy in calibration processes.The technology behind remote calibration includes diagnostic tools that communicate wirelessly with a vehicle’s onboard systems.

These tools can access real-time data, allowing technicians to make precise adjustments based on the vehicle’s specific needs. By leveraging cloud-based platforms and remote access software, professionals can perform calibrations quickly and efficiently.

Challenges of Implementing Remote Calibration

Despite the many benefits, implementing remote calibration services can pose several challenges. Common obstacles include the high initial investment in technology and the need for specialized training for technicians. Additionally, ensuring a stable internet connection for remote access can be a significant hurdle, especially in less urbanized areas.Overcoming these technical challenges may involve investing in improved infrastructure and providing ongoing education for staff.

Regulatory considerations also play a critical role, as businesses must navigate compliance with industry standards and local regulations when adopting remote calibration technologies.

FAQ Summary

What is remote calibration?

Remote calibration involves adjusting vehicle settings and diagnostics through online tools without the need for physical presence at a service location.

How does remote calibration improve vehicle performance?

It ensures vehicles are tuned to optimal specifications, enhancing efficiency and safety while reducing downtime for repairs.

Is remote calibration suitable for all vehicle types?

Yes, remote calibration can be beneficial for a variety of vehicles, including hybrids and electric models, adapting to their specific calibration needs.

How can repair shops implement remote calibration services?

Repair shops can integrate remote calibration by investing in the necessary technology and training staff to use remote diagnostic tools effectively.

What are the challenges of remote calibration?

Common challenges include technical issues, regulatory compliance, and ensuring data security during remote adjustments.
